If your code module is a large number of lines, the ability to integrate the code into the blocks would be convenient. The code block can not use the "Process Control - Goto", but it is possible within a block of code.
You can also add the ability to protect from editing some blocks (the lock icon in the second half of the image).
Note: I used the "Wait (loop)" to draw an example - there is an old icon.
Example:

 
                    

 
        
 
                                
                            
                        
